结论:龙蜥操作系统(Anolis OS)并非基于CentOS,而是由阿里云主导的OpenAnolis社区推出的独立Linux发行版,其设计目标是兼容RHEL/CentOS生态,但采用更开放的社区协作模式和创新技术路线。
以下是详细说明:
1. 龙蜥操作系统的背景与定位
- 起源:龙蜥操作系统由阿里云于2021年推出,是OpenAnolis社区的核心项目,旨在为云原生和传统企业场景提供高性能、高稳定的Linux支持。
- 与CentOS的关系:
- 非CentOS分支:龙蜥并非基于CentOS代码直接衍生,而是通过兼容RHEL/CentOS二进制接口(ABI/API)实现生态替代。
- 替代方案:在CentOS转向Stream版本后,龙蜥成为国内重要的替代选择之一,尤其针对需要长期稳定支持(LTS)的用户。
2. 技术路线与核心差异
- 独立演进:
- 龙蜥基于Linux内核和开源组件自主构建,不依赖CentOS代码库,但通过Anolis OS 8等版本提供与RHEL 8的二进制兼容性。
- 创新特性:如Anolis Kernel(优化云计算场景)、分层架构支持(同时兼容新旧应用)。
- 社区驱动:
- 采用开放治理模式(OpenAnolis基金会),与CentOS由Red Hat单一主导的模式不同。
3. 与CentOS的对比优势
- 长期支持承诺:
- 提供10年维护周期(CentOS Stream仅滚动更新),更适合企业关键业务。
- 本土化服务:
- 针对我国用户优化(如硬件适配、合规要求),而CentOS更侧重全球通用性。
- 云原生集成:
- 默认集成容器、安全增强等云时代特性,减少二次开发成本。
4. 用户适用场景
- 推荐使用龙蜥的情况:
- 需要国产化替代或规避CentOS停更风险;
- 依赖RHEL生态但希望获得更长生命周期支持;
- 云计算/高性能计算场景需深度优化。
- 仍需谨慎评估的情况:
- 对CentOS历史版本有强依赖的遗留系统;
- 国际化团队需与海外生态严格一致。
总结:龙蜥操作系统是独立于CentOS的下一代企业级Linux发行版,通过兼容性设计和创新技术填补了CentOS转型后的市场空白,尤其适合我国企业和云服务用户。其核心价值在于自主可控、长期稳定、云场景优化,而非简单的“CentOS复刻”。